ENVIRONMENTAL BOARD MEETING APRIL 30, 2008 <br />4 DRAFT MINUTES <br />9. A concrete wash out area was present, but there was evidence of recent <br />concrete wash out on a parcel of land on the other side of the <br />development (not always using the designated wash out area). <br />10. There did not appear to be any use of water gardens as recommended. <br /> <br />Mr. Asleson stated this was not a conservation development. With the <br />Resource Management Plan most of future developments will be <br />considered conservation developments. <br /> <br />Ms. Brouillet questioned if the city building inspectors could check <br />garbage, silt fences, etc. when they are on-site doing inspections. She <br />stated a possibility would be to add a couple dollars to the building permit <br />fees to pay for the new forms. It was decided that a letter be sent to <br />Michael Grochala, Community Development Director and Jim Studenski, <br />City Engineer regarding issues stated above. Ms. O’Dea will email a draft <br />letter to Mr. Asleson for review and then he will forwarded to appropriate <br />staff when complete. <br /> <br />F.
